DNS故障排查技巧:如何解决DNS无法解析的问题

时间:2025-04-21 16:48:15 分类:电脑硬件

DNS(域名系统)是现代互联网的基石,其作用如同人类社会中的地址系统,确保用户能够通过简单的域名访问复杂的网络资源。DNS解析失败是网民常见的困扰之一,可能由多种因素引起,影响上网体验。掌握有效的DNS故障排查技巧显得尤为重要。

DNS故障排查技巧:如何解决DNS无法解析的问题

针对DNS无法解析的问题,确认是否是用户本机的问题。通过运用命令行工具进行基本的连通性测试,可以识别出是本地故障还是网络供应商的问题。具体来说,使用ping命令检查目标域名是否能够正常访问,如果响应正常但网址无法打开,问题可能出在DNS解析上。

接下来的步骤是验证DNS服务器的设置。在电脑或路由器的网络配置中,确认DNS服务器的地址是否输入正确。常见的公共DNS服务器如Google的8.8.8.8和Cloudflare的1.1.1.1,通过手动设置这些地址,能够有效提升解析速度和稳定性。

网络范围较广的情况下,路由器的DNS缓存可能会导致故障。定期清理路由器的DNS缓存,对于保持网络畅通至关重要。大多数路由器都提供在后台管理界面中刷新DNS缓存的选项,只需少许步骤即可完成。

如果以上步骤仍未解决问题,DNS查询工具如nslookup和dig会非常有用。通过这些工具,可以进一步分析DNS记录的详细信息,检查是否出现了过期的记录或配置错误。这些工具能够显示出DNS解析的每一步,有助于快速准确地定位问题。

现今,网民对DNS性能的要求不断提高,因此一些企业也逐渐开始推出自家的DNS服务。选择一个合适的DNS服务提供商,不仅能够获得更高的解析速度,还能享受到更好的安全性和稳定性。近年来,DNS-over-HTTPS(DoH)和DNS-over-TLS(DoT)等技术也逐步兴起,它们通过加密传输提高了用户的隐私保护,值得在故障排查时关注。

故障排查不仅需要技巧与工具,也需要耐心。掌握这些DNS故障排查的基础知识,会让用户在面对互联网连接问题时,能够冷静应对,迅速找出并解决问题。

常见问题解答(FAQ)

1. 什么是DNS解析失败?

DNS解析失败是指用户使用域名访问网站时,系统无法将域名转换为相应的IP地址,从而导致无法访问该网站。

2. 如何测试DNS服务器是否工作正常?

可以使用命令行中的nslookup命令测试DNS服务器,输入一个域名并查看返回的IP地址信息。

3. 清理DNS缓存有什么作用?

清理DNS缓存能够删除过期或错误的DNS记录,帮助解决因缓存数据造成的解析问题。

4. 选择哪个公共DNS服务更好?

Google DNS(8.8.8.8)和Cloudflare DNS(1.1.1.1)都是广受欢迎的选择,前者以稳定性著称,后者则以速度和隐私闻名。

5. DNS-over-HTTPS是什么?

DNS-over-HTTPS(DoH)是一种通过安全HTTPS连接进行DNS查询的技术,通过加密保护用户的DNS请求,提升隐私安全性。